Yield Analysis and Phytochemical Screening of Ethanol Extract of Phaleria macrocarpa Leaves

Ira Cinta Lestari, Dharma Lindarto, Syafruddin Ilyas, Tri Widyawati, Suryani Eka Mustika

Abstract


Phaleria macrocarpa leaves have the potential to be used as raw materials for medicines derived from natural ingredients, but research is needed to determine the content and efficacy of these plants. This study aims to analyze the yield and screening of the content of phytochemical compounds in the ethanolic extract of the Phaleria macrocarpa leaves. This research is a descriptive study. Extract yield analysis was performed by calculating the weight ratio of the extract divided by the simplicia multiplied by one hundred percent. Screening for the phytochemical content was carried out for compounds belonging to the class of flavonoids, saponins, tannins, alkaloids, steroids, and triterpenoids. The results of the calculation of the yield of the extract obtained were 14.58% and the results of the phytochemical test showed that the extract contained flavonoids, alkaloids, tannins, glycosides, saponins, and steroids.
